In further detail the accommodation includes an entrance hall with stairs access to the first floor, access to the open plan living spaces and a cloaks/WC comprising a low level WC and a wash basin with mixer tap. The impressive open plan living, dining and kitchen area is understandably the heart of the home. The fitted kitchen sits to the front and comprises base and wall units, roll top work-surfaces and a mixture of integrated and freestanding appliances. The integrated items include an electric oven, a gas hob with extractor over and a glass splashback, and a washing machine and there is space for a freestanding fridge freezer and a useful storage cupboard can also house a condenser dryer. A uPVC double glazed window and led downlighting provide plenty of lighting to this area.
The adjacent dining area can comfortably seat four people on a day to day basis and in turn opens to the generous lounge. A drop down pendant light sits above the designated table space. UPVC double glazed double doors with matching side window panels allow plenty of natural light into the whole open plan space and permit pleasant views over the rear garden and beyond. A media wall panel with led backlighting and fixed cabinetry below sits on one wall and there are two fixed ceiling light points overhead.
The first floor landing provides access to two double bedrooms and the bathroom. The larger of the two bedrooms sits to the rear of the property and boasts fitted wardrobes along the length of one wall, bespoke wall panelling to the wall opposite and ample space for further bedroom furniture. The front facing bedroom is a good double room with plenty of space for furniture and features twin uPVC double glazed windows with a pleasant open aspect in addition to a built-in storage cupboard. Completing the accommodation is the modern bathroom. Fitted with a three piece suite in white, the bathroom comprises a panelled bath with mixer tap and shower over, a vanity wash hand basin with mixer tap and a close coupled WC. There are fully tiled walls, an electric shaver point and a heated towel rail.
This modest development was well finished externally and the property benefits from a block paved driveway suitable for tandem parking for two vehicles. The rear garden is a particularly generous size for a modern development and is fully enclosed by timber fencing. A patio seating area extends onto a grassed lawn with paved verges and pathways. At the far end of the garden a right hand dogleg turn opens into a further garden area with the grassed lawn continuing into this space. Fixed outdoor solar lights have been attached to the fence posts ensuring that this is a space that can be enjoyed both in the daytime and evening. There is also a separate access to the back garden that allows travel to and from the garden without needing to go through the property itself.
